         <description><![CDATA[<div>by Holly Schindler<br>Genre:&nbsp; Realistic Fiction<br><br>One girl's trash really is another girl's treasure.&nbsp; August has to move to a new school&nbsp; because her old school has been closed.&nbsp; The new school has all of the richey kids and August feels out of place.&nbsp; One of the other kids dad works to condemn everyones house in August's neighborhood.&nbsp; August tries to help them.<br>I love this book because August is such a nice girl and she never gives up.&nbsp; It was also written by an author from around here.<br>Charles DeLaSalle</div>]]></description>
